Dhulwa Population - Wardha, Maharashtra
Dhulwa is a medium size village located in Wardha Taluka of Wardha district, Maharashtra with total 103 families residing. The Dhulwa village has population of 385 of which 194 are males while 191 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dhulwa village population of children with age 0-6 is 33 which makes up 8.57 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dhulwa village is 985 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Dhulwa as per census is 1063, higher than Maharashtra average of 894.
Dhulwa village has lower liter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Dhulwa village was 73.01 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Dhulwa Male literacy stands at 76.97 % while female literacy rate was 68.97 %.

Dhulwa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 103 | - | - |
Population | 385 | 194 | 191 |
Child (0-6) | 33 | 16 | 17 |
Schedule Caste | 85 | 38 | 47 |
Schedule Tribe | 90 | 42 | 48 |
Literacy | 73.01 % | 76.97 % | 68.97 % |
Total Workers | 235 | 132 | 103 |
Main Worker | 235 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 0 | 0 | 0 |
